Iot SDK 4.0.0
载入中...
搜索中...
未找到
事件回调处理概述

会话事件在网络线程中回调 jrtc_handler_t 中的成员指针 更多...

结构体

struct  jrtc_slice_t
 相对某个起始地址的数据片 更多...
 
struct  jrtc_handler_t
 会话中的事件处理函数集合 更多...
 

宏定义

#define JRTC_ROLE_SENDER   0x2
 发送者
 
#define JRTC_ROLE_PLAYER   0x4
 演示者, 其事件将被广播
 
#define JRTC_ROLE_OWNER   0x8
 唯一的拥有者
 
#define JRTC_STATUS_FORWARD_VIDEO   0x1
 通话时, 视频是否被转发
 
#define JRTC_STATUS_FORWARD_AUDIO   0x2
 通话时, 音频是否被转发
 
#define JRTC_STATUS_VIDEO   0x4
 本地, 视频设备是否可发送
 
#define JRTC_STATUS_AUDIO   0x8
 本地, 音频设备是否可发送
 
#define JRTC_STATUS_MEDIA   (JRTC_STATUS_AUDIO|JRTC_STATUS_VIDEO)
 本地, 音视频设备的是否可发送
 
#define JRTC_SENDING_AUDIO   (JRTC_STATUS_AUDIO|JRTC_STATUS_FORWARD_AUDIO)
 最终是否处于发送音频状态
 
#define JRTC_SENDING_VIDEO   (JRTC_STATUS_VIDEO|JRTC_STATUS_FORWARD_VIDEO)
 最终是否处于发送视频状态
 

详细描述

会话事件在网络线程中回调 jrtc_handler_t 中的成员指针

宏定义说明

◆ JRTC_ROLE_SENDER

#define JRTC_ROLE_SENDER   0x2

发送者

在文件 jrtc.h224 行定义.

◆ JRTC_ROLE_PLAYER

#define JRTC_ROLE_PLAYER   0x4

演示者, 其事件将被广播

在文件 jrtc.h226 行定义.

◆ JRTC_ROLE_OWNER

#define JRTC_ROLE_OWNER   0x8

唯一的拥有者

在文件 jrtc.h228 行定义.

◆ JRTC_STATUS_FORWARD_VIDEO

#define JRTC_STATUS_FORWARD_VIDEO   0x1

通话时, 视频是否被转发

在文件 jrtc.h232 行定义.

◆ JRTC_STATUS_FORWARD_AUDIO

#define JRTC_STATUS_FORWARD_AUDIO   0x2

通话时, 音频是否被转发

在文件 jrtc.h234 行定义.

◆ JRTC_STATUS_VIDEO

#define JRTC_STATUS_VIDEO   0x4

本地, 视频设备是否可发送

在文件 jrtc.h236 行定义.

◆ JRTC_STATUS_AUDIO

#define JRTC_STATUS_AUDIO   0x8

本地, 音频设备是否可发送

在文件 jrtc.h238 行定义.

◆ JRTC_STATUS_MEDIA

#define JRTC_STATUS_MEDIA   (JRTC_STATUS_AUDIO|JRTC_STATUS_VIDEO)

本地, 音视频设备的是否可发送

在文件 jrtc.h240 行定义.

◆ JRTC_SENDING_AUDIO

#define JRTC_SENDING_AUDIO   (JRTC_STATUS_AUDIO|JRTC_STATUS_FORWARD_AUDIO)

最终是否处于发送音频状态

在文件 jrtc.h242 行定义.

◆ JRTC_SENDING_VIDEO

#define JRTC_SENDING_VIDEO   (JRTC_STATUS_VIDEO|JRTC_STATUS_FORWARD_VIDEO)

最终是否处于发送视频状态

在文件 jrtc.h244 行定义.